[Instant News/Comprehensive Report] U.S. Secretary of State Blinken (Antony Blinken) tweeted earlier that he had a phone call with Qin Gang, who had just been appointed as China’s foreign minister, and the two sides discussed U.S.-China relations during the phone call.

China appointed Qin Gang, its ambassador to the United States, as foreign minister on December 30 last year, replacing Wang Yi, who had served as China's foreign minister for the past 10 years. Wang Yi was promoted to a member of the Political Bureau of the Communist Party of China in October last year.

Qin Gang previously served as Director of the Information Department, Director of the Protocol Department, and Deputy Minister of the Chinese Ministry of Foreign Affairs, and was transferred to the Chinese Ambassador to the United States in 2021. He is a close friend of Chinese President Xi Jinping.

Blinken tweeted at 1:10 pm local time on the 1st (Taiwan time 2:10 this morning), saying that he had a call with Qin Gang, who was about to leave Washington, and that the two sides discussed US-China relations, and Maintain open lines of communication.
